Insulating glazing units

Double pane insulated windows are a fantastic way of increasing the insulation value of your windows over time. It's also a great way to reduce energy consumption. However it is more expensive than ordinary glass.

In insulated glazing, bicheck.kuokuk.com two glass panes are separated by the spacer. The spacer is typically composed of thermoplastic or aluminum material. The width of the spacer determines the gap between the glass panes. Another factor that determines the insulation of the unit is the thickness of the glass.

The thickness of glass for an IGU can range from 3 to 10 millimeters. The glass can be laminated or made to be tempered. You can also have up to four panes per unit.

The gas filling between glass panes helps to keep the indoor temperature cool. It also prevents heat from leaving the building. This helps keep your home warm in winter and cool in summer. It also reduces the amount of noise that enters the building.

Insulating glazing units can be replaced and are extremely durable. The quality of the materials used will determine the lifetime of the unit. Generally, IGUs carry a warranty of between 10 and 20 years. This is contingent upon the location in which the unit is placed, the quality of workmanship and the temperature differences between the outside and the inside of the building.
